背景技术
现如今,市面上出现越来越多的双面屏手机,双面屏手机的设计方案同时也要求位于移动终端正反两面的出音口都可以听到声音。目前,移动终端的正反两面的出音口都可以听到声音的设计方案包括如下两种:第一种方案,在移动终端中设置两个听筒器件,该两个听筒器件可以重叠在一起,也可以并排摆放,分别用两个听筒的正面出音,后音腔封闭;第二种方案,使用一个听筒,利用同一个听筒的正反两个面同时出音,该一个听筒的正反两面分别对应移动终端的正反两面中的一个面。
然而,第一种方案中是采用两个听筒器件,而听筒器件的成本较高,因此采用第一种方案生产的移动终端的成本较高;除此之外,移动终端的空间尺寸往往不允许设置两个听筒器件,尤其是将两个听筒器件重叠在一起,很大程度上加大了移动终端的厚度;而移动终端的正反两面共用一个听筒器件的技术方案,无论移动需要移动终端的正面的出音口还是反面的出音口出音,听筒器件均开放出音,如此会出现失真和音量小等问题,主观音质较差。
综上所述,相关技术方案中缺少一种堆叠空间允许、且出音的音质较好的双面出音的技术方案。

本公开实施例提供一种移动终端及出音口的切换方法,所述移动终端中设置有一个听筒,且所述移动终端的相背的两个表面上均可出音,具体地,根据检测到需要出音的表面控制相应的出音口出音,而另一表面的导音通道被封闭,如此,有效克服了设置两个听筒器件造成的空间不允许的技术问题;同时,在一个出音口出音时,另外一个出音口对应的出音通道被封闭,有效克服了两个出音口同时出音导致传达出的声音失真或音量小等问题。
图1为本公开实施例提供的移动终端的结构示意图,参见图1所示,移动终端1包括框体11和供所述框体11伸出或缩入的开口12,在所述框体11内设置有音腔111、听筒112和光学器件模组113、以及分别与所述音腔111连通的第一出音口114和第二出音口115,所述听筒112与所述音腔111连通。
所述移动终端1还包括第一出音通道13、第二出音通道14和伸缩机构(图1中未示出),所述第一导音通道13的一端延伸至所述移动终端的第一表面,另一端朝向所述框体,所述伸缩机构与所述框体11连接;
所述第二导音通道14的一端延伸至所述移动终端1的第二表面,另一端朝向所述框体11,所述第一表面和所述第二表面为所述移动终端相背的两个表面;
在所述伸缩机构的驱动下,所述光学器件模组113可至少部分伸出所述开口使所述光学器件模组位于第一位置,或全部通过所述开口12缩入所述移动终端内使所述光学器件模组位于第二位置;
参见图2所示,在所述光学器件模组113位于第二位置的情况下,即所述光学器件模组113位于所述移动终端内,所述第一导音通道13与所述第一出音口114隔断,所述第二导音通道14与所述第二出音口115连通;
参见图3所示,在所述光学器件模组113位于第一位置的情况下,即当所述光学器件模组113至少部分伸出所述开口12,所述第一导音通道13与所述第一出音口连通,所述第二导音通道与所述第二出音口隔断。
在本公开实施例中,所述伸缩机构可通过马达来控制,可选地,当通过马达控制所述伸缩机构的伸缩杆处于伸展状态时,可使所述光学器件模组113至少部分伸出所述开口;而当通过马达控制所述伸缩机构的伸缩杆处于压缩状态时,可使所述光学器件模组113全部通过所述开口12缩入所述移动终端内。
参见图4所示,在本公开实施例中,所述第一出音口114、所述第二出音口115与所述听筒112的距离不等,如图中,第一出音口114与听筒112的距离d1与第二出音口115与听筒112的距离d2不同。基于第一出音口114、第二出音口115距离听筒112的距离不相同,因此,用户可跟根据需求选择需要出音的为第一出音口114还是第二出音口115,如当需要传达出的声音较大时,则可选择距离听筒的距离较小的出音口,而当需要传出的声音较小时,则可选择距离听筒的距离较大的出音口。
进一步地,在本公开实施例中,第二出音口115与听筒112的距离d2大于第一出音口114与听筒112的距离d1。基于第一出音口114与听筒112的距离较小,相应的,通过第一出音口114对应的第一表面传达出的声音较大,因此,用户可根据需求音量选择需要出音的出音口为第一出音口114或第二出音口115,如当需要传达出较大的声音时,可以选择使用第一出音口114出音,而当需要传出较小的音量时,可以选择使用第二出音口115出音。
在本公开实施例中,光学器件模组靠近开口12设置,如此,听筒112设置在远离开口12的位置。通过音腔的第一出音口114或第二出音口115传出。可选地,在本公开实施例中,听筒112的出音面朝上设置,如此,可有效保障听筒发出的声音进入音腔。
在本公开实施例中,第一导音通道13与所述第二导音通道14平行,可选地,第一导音通道13垂直于第一出音口114所在的截面设置,第二导音通道14垂直于第二出音口115所在的截面设置。作为一种可选的实施例,第一导音通道13与第二导音通道14位于同一水平面。
在本公开实施例中,至于确定需要出音的出音口为第一出音口114还是第二出音口115,可采用如下方法:在移动终端的相背的两个表面分别设置一个距离传感器,当移动终端接收到某一个表面上的距离传感器的检测信号后, 便确定该表面相对应的出音口为需要出音的出音口。如参见图5,在移动终端的第一表面设置第一距离传感器151,在移动终端的第二表面设置第二距离传感器152,当移动终端接收到第一距离传感器151的检测信号后,便确定第一表面对应的第一出音口114为需要出音的出音口;而当移动终端接收到第二距离传感器152的检测信号后,便确定第二表面对应的第二出音口115为需要出音的出音口。
在本公开实施例中,所述移动终端还包括控制器(图中未示出),参见图6所示,控制器16分别与所述第一距离传感器151、第二距离传感器152和所述伸缩机构17连接。
当所述移动终端接收到所述第一距离传感器151的检测信号后,发送第一控制信号给控制器16,使所述控制器16通过所述伸缩机构17驱动所述框体以使所述第一导音通道13与所述第一出音口114连通,所述第二导音通道14与所述第二出音口115隔断;具体的,可通过控制所述伸缩机构17处于延伸状态,以使所述框体至少部分伸出所述出口,从而使第一导音通道13与第一出音口114连通,而第二出音口115被遮挡,从而使第二导音通道14与第二出音口115隔断;
当所述移动终端接收所述第二距离传感器152的检测信号,发送第二控制信号至控制器16使所述控制器16通过所述伸缩机构17驱动所述框体11,以使所述第一导音通道13与所述第一出音口114隔断,所述第二导音通道14与所述第二出音口115连通。具体地,控制器16可以控制驱动所述伸缩机构17处于压缩状态,以使所述框体完全缩入所述移动终端中,从而使所述第二导音通道14与所述第二出音口115连通,第一出音口114被遮挡,从而使所述第一导音通道13与所述第一出音口114隔断。
在本公开实施例中,所述第一距离传感器151与第二距离传感器152可均为红外传感器,如第一距离传感器151为第一红外传感器,第二距离传感器152为第二红外传感器,当第一距离传感器151或第二距离传感器152感测到预设距离范围内的用户时,便形成检测信号。如当用户采用第一表面靠近耳朵,当第一距离传感器与用户的耳朵的距离在所述预设距离范围内时,则第一红距离感器151检测到用户,形成检测信号;当用户采用第二表面靠 近耳朵时,当第二距离传感器与用户的耳朵的距离在所述预设距离范围内时,则第二距离152传感器检测到用户,形成检测信号。在此指出,所述预设距离范围可以依据第一、第二红外传感器的性能及用户需求而进行设定。
在本公开实施例中,所述光学器件模组113为摄像头模组。本公开实施例中,将听筒112与光学器件模组113集成在一起,听筒112与光学器件模组113一起升降,可有效节约空间,降低了方案实施的难度。
